Why buy the Insulated Steel Roller Shutter Doors?

Thermal Protection, Strength & Quiet Operation for Demanding Industrial Environments

The Insulated Industrial Roller Shutter Door is purpose-built to deliver outstanding performance in temperature-sensitive, high-traffic, or noise-controlled environments. Whether you're securing a warehouse, logistics centre, factory, or commercial building, this shutter system helps reduce heat loss, minimise noise, and protect assets—while meeting modern energy-efficiency and safety expectations.

Available in three robust slat profiles—77mm, 95mm, and 100mm—this range allows you to choose the perfect balance of thermal insulation, strength, and size compatibility for your specific project needs.


Thermal and Acoustic Insulation

All models feature:

  •    CFC-free PU or rigid foam insulation
  •   Minimal thermal bridges through advanced curtain design
  •   Perimeter sealing to reduce both heat transmission and operational noise
Slat SizeU-Value / Thermal ResistanceMax Opening SizeTypical Use Cases
77mm4.01 W/m²K6000mm W × 20m² areaInternal partitions, smaller bays
95mmCentre: 1.1 W/m²K, Quirk: 3.2 W/m²K7000mm W × 44m² areaLarger commercial openings
100mm(Performance TBC)7000mm W × 49m² areaHeavy-duty or exposed applications

 

Durable Steel Construction with Enhanced Strength

  •    All three profiles use twin-walled steel slats, increasing impact resistance and structural rigidity
  •   The 100mm slat offers the greatest protection with a hardened steel body—ideal for harsh or high-wind environments
  •   Available in:
    •       Galvanised finish (standard)
    •       Powder-coated (any RAL/BS colour)
    •       Optional plastisol coating or lamination (on 95mm and 100mm slats)
       

Flexible Motor & Control Options

  •    Comes with GfA motor as standard
  •   Available in:
    •       Direct drive, inboard, single-phase, or three-phase configurations
  •   Control options:
    •       Wall switches
    •       Keypads
    •       Remote control
    •       BMS/fire system integration
       

Vision Panels (Available for 95mm & 100mm)

  •  95mm: 160mm x 58mm Clear Perspex
  • 100mm: 200mm x 55mm Clear Perspex
  • Perfect for retail warehouses, showrooms, or zones requiring light transmission
     

Wind Load & Sealing

  •    Wind class rating: Class 5 on 95mm and 100mm shutters (high resistance to wind pressure)
  •   Includes twin pile brush seals, EPDM bottom rail seals, and polypropylene endlocks for enhanced insulation and quieter operation

Security Features

  • Twin-Wall Steel Construction (95mm & 100mm): Enhances durability and minimises deflection from impacts.
  • Polypropylene Plastic Endlocks (100mm model): Provide robust slat alignment and increase resistance against forced entry
  • Wind Class Rating – Class 5 (95mm & 100mm): Ensures high resistance to wind loads – suitable for exposed industrial sites
  • Optional Vision Panels:
    •   95mm: 160 × 58 mm clear perspex
    •   100mm: 200 × 55 mm clear perspex
  •   Maintain visual access while retaining shutter integrity

     

Safety Features

  • Acoustic Insulation: PU rigid foam (77mm & 95mm) or CFC-free infill (100mm) plus sealing around the shutter perimeter dampens operational and environmental noise
  • EPDM Rubber Weather Seal (100mm): Installed on bottom rail for better sealing against the floor and weather protection
  • Twin Pile Brush Strips (100mm): Positioned in guides to minimise dust, debris, and finger entrapment
  • High Stability: All models use guide angles and robust profiles designed to withstand industrial use.

 

Insulation & Energy Efficiency

  •    Thermal Insulation Ratings:
    • 77mm: 4.01 W/(m²·K)
    • 95mm: Centre = 1.1 W/(m²·K); Quirk = 3.2 W/(m²·K)
    • 100mm: Value TBC, but design includes deep cavity and twin-wall profile for superior insulation
  • Infill Material:
    •   77mm & 95mm: Fine-pored PU foam
    •   100mm: CFC-free foam for enhanced thermal protection
  • Weight per m²:
    •   77mm: 11.4 kg
    •   95mm: 13.15 kg
    •   100mm: ~13+ kg estimated based on structure
       

Operation & Controls

  •    Motor Types:
    •   GfA motor standard on all models
    •   Available in Direct Drive, Inboard, Single Phase, or 3 Phase depending on requirement
  •   Control Options: Can include push buttons, key switches, remote control, motion/presence sensors (via control system selection).
  •   Custom Motor Integration: Each model allows motor selection based on usage, speed, and environment.

 

Installation & Warranty

  •    Max Width & Height:
    • 77mm: 6000 mm width / 20 m² max area
    • 95mm: 7000 mm height & width / 44 m² max area
    • 100mm: 7000 mm height & width / 49 m² max area
  •   Guide Angles:
    •       77mm: 75mm × 50mm
    •       95mm & 100mm: 100mm × 50mm
  •   4 Guide Arrangement Options: Suited for various mounting and wind resistance scenarios.
  •   Powder Coating Post-Assembly: Ensures consistent finish even on assembled curtain profiles.
